Choosing the Perfect Ombre Colors

The first step in creating ombre nails is to choose your colors. For a summery look, we recommend using bright and cheerful colors, such as pinks, oranges, yellows, and blues. You can also use metallic colors, such as gold or silver, to add a touch of glamour. If you’re not sure what colors to choose, you can always ask your nail technician for advice.

Applying the Acrylic Base

Once you’ve chosen your colors, it’s time to apply the acrylic base. This will create a strong and durable foundation for your ombre design. To apply the acrylic base, start by filing your nails to the desired shape and length. Then, apply a thin layer of nail primer to help the acrylic adhere to your nails. Next, apply a small amount of acrylic powder to the nail bed and use a brush to smooth it out. Allow the acrylic to dry completely before moving on to the next step.

Creating the Ombre Effect

Now it’s time to create the ombre effect. To do this, you’ll need to use a makeup sponge. Start by applying a small amount of your lightest color to the sponge. Then, apply a small amount of your darkest color to the other end of the sponge. Use a toothpick or a paintbrush to blend the two colors together. Once you’re happy with the blend, dab the sponge onto your nails. Be sure to apply even pressure so that the colors blend smoothly. Allow the polish to dry completely before moving on to the next step.

Adding the Finishing Touches

The final step is to add the finishing touches to your ombre nails. You can add a top coat to protect the polish and give it a glossy finish. You can also add some nail art, such as glitter or rhinestones, to give your nails a more personalized look.

Troubleshooting Common Ombre Nail Problems

If you’re having trouble creating ombre nails, here are a few troubleshooting tips:

  • If the colors are not blending smoothly, try using a makeup sponge that is slightly damp.
  • If the polish is too thick, try adding a few drops of nail polish thinner.
  • If the polish is too thin, try adding a few drops of nail polish hardener.
  • If the ombre effect is not visible, try applying more layers of polish.
  • If the polish is chipping or peeling, try applying a base coat before the ombre polish.

FAQ about Simple Summer Acrylic Nails Ombre

What is an ombre nail?

An ombre nail is a type of nail art that features a gradual blend of two or more colors.

How can I create an ombre effect on my nails?

You can create an ombre effect using a sponge and multiple nail polish colors. Apply the colors to the sponge, then dab it onto your nails to create the gradient effect.

What colors are best for a summer ombre look?

Light and bright colors, such as pink, orange, yellow, and blue, are popular choices for summer ombre nails.

What kind of acrylic nails are best for ombre?

Short to medium-length almond or square-shaped nails are ideal for ombre designs.

How do I prepare my nails for ombre acrylics?

Start by filing your nails to the desired shape and length. Then, push back your cuticles and buff the surface of your nails.

How do I apply ombre acrylic nails?

Apply a thin layer of acrylic to your nails and allow it to dry. Then, create an ombre effect by applying different colors of acrylic and blending them together.

How do I seal ombre acrylic nails?

Once the ombre effect is complete, apply a top coat to seal the design.

How long can ombre acrylic nails last?

With proper care, ombre acrylic nails can last up to 2-3 weeks.

How do I remove ombre acrylic nails?

To remove ombre acrylic nails, soak them in acetone for 10-15 minutes. Then, gently scrape off the acrylic using a nail file or cuticle pusher.

What are some tips for getting the perfect ombre look?

Use a makeup sponge for a smoother gradient, practice on fake nails before applying to your real nails, and experiment with different color combinations to find the perfect look.
